The scarf, whether of winter wool or summer silk, makes a statement, embellishes a look: in short, it is an indispensable accessory for the perfect final touch. Long reserved for ladies, the scarf first entered the male wardrobe in the 17th century, thanks to the soldiers of the Croatian army, who wore it so as to recognise their various factions. It was later adopted by the men of Europe’s royal courts.
